The Science Behind Weather Forecasting

The precision of a weather forecast depends greatly on the quality and quantity of information gathered. Weather information is sourced from a range of instruments, consisting of ground-based weather stations, satellites, and radar systems. These tools step essential climatic variables like temperature, humidity, wind speed, and pressure. Satellites, for instance, provide real-time images of cloud developments and storm systems, while radar assists identify rainfall and its strength.

Once this data is gathered, it is processed through mathematical weather prediction (NWP) designs. These designs use complicated mathematical equations to simulate the environment's dynamics and anticipate future weather patterns. Different kinds of designs exist, with some covering the whole globe and others focusing on particular regions with higher information. Nevertheless, the role of human meteorologists remains essential, as they analyze the design outputs, adjust them for local conditions, and communicate uncertainties to the general public.

Comprehending Different Weather Forecasts

Weather forecasts can vary considerably depending upon the time frame they cover and the specific needs they deal with. Short-term forecasts, generally covering up to 48 hours, are extremely detailed and trusted, making them vital for everyday planning. Medium-term forecasts, covering from three to seven days, offer a more comprehensive view and work for more extended preparation purposes.

Long-term forecasts, which look weeks or even months ahead, concentrate on trends rather than specific conditions and are typically used in industries like farming. In addition to these general forecasts, there are specialized ones customized for specific sectors, such as air travel, marine operations, and agriculture, which consider unique ecological factors.

The Challenges and Limitations of Weather Forecasting

Regardless of the considerable progress made in weather forecasting, a number of challenges stay. The intrinsic uncertainty of the designs used can cause variations in forecasts, as different designs may anticipate slightly different results. This is why ensemble forecasting, which runs multiple designs to assess a variety of possibilities, is often utilized.

Information gaps likewise posture a challenge, especially in remote areas or over oceans where less observations are readily homepage available. The chaotic nature of the environment further makes complex predictions, specifically for long-term forecasts, which are typically less exact.

Interpreting Weather Forecasts

Comprehending how to check out and translate a weather report can greatly improve its usefulness. Weather signs are a common function in forecasts, with icons representing sun, clouds, rain, and other conditions. Terms like "partly cloudy" or "chance of showers" suggest the likelihood of specific weather taking place.

Wind forecasts are also crucial, particularly for outside activities and air travel. Wind direction and speed can have a considerable influence on temperature perception and weather patterns. In addition, air pressure trends are key signs of changing weather, with high-pressure systems typically bringing clear skies and low-pressure systems related to stormier conditions.

Extreme weather local weather radar alerts are an important part of weather forecasts, providing warnings for hazardous conditions like thunderstorms, tornadoes, or cyclones. These signals are crucial for security and preparedness, helping communities take the needed preventative measures.
